BTQ Technologies Invests in Keypair to Co‑Develop Post‑Quantum Security IP
December 18, 2025
BTQ Technologies announced a strategic investment in Keypair, a Korean full‑stack security company, to co‑own Keypair's post‑quantum cryptography (PQC) intellectual property and jointly develop hardware‑rooted, infrastructure‑grade security solutions. The partnership expands BTQ's footprint in South Korea and leverages Keypair's deployments across defense, energy and financial services to accelerate commercial integration of BTQ's quantum‑safe security roadmap.

IonQ Acquires Controlling Stake in ID Quantique
May 6, 2025
Cybersecurity
IonQ has completed the acquisition of a controlling stake in ID Quantique (IDQ), adding IDQ's quantum key distribution (QKD) systems, quantum random number generators (QRNGs) and single-photon detectors to its product portfolio. The deal expands IonQ's quantum networking and secure-communications capabilities, brings nearly 300 granted and pending patents to IonQ's IP estate, and strengthens its position in national and international quantum communications initiatives.

HUB Cyber Security Acquires QPoint Technologies
April 4, 2024
IT Services
HUB Cyber Security Ltd (Nasdaq: HUBC) completed a cash acquisition of QPoint Technologies, taking full ownership of the company to advance HUB's secure data fabric ecosystem. QPoint — an Israel-based provider of software engineering, testing, ICT and cybersecurity services with FY23 revenue of about $26 million and 100+ customers including Rafael and the Israel Airport Authority — will expand HUB's capabilities and cross-selling opportunities across government, defense, healthcare and financial end markets.

Quadrant Private Equity Backs Three New Zealand Cybersecurity Firms
March 30, 2023
Cybersecurity
Quadrant Private Equity’s $530 million second growth fund has invested in three New Zealand cybersecurity businesses — Quantum Security Services, ZX Security and Helix Security Services — which provide GRC, penetration testing, cloud security and cyber advisory services. The trio serves over 200 enterprise and government customers and has seen combined revenue grow more than 35% over the past three years; the firms have been brought together as part of a broader consolidation in the New Zealand cybersecurity market.
